When it comes to adding depth and dimension to a room, mirrors are always the way to go! Mirrors can make rooms feel larger, brighter, and more styled if done the right way. However, mirrors can be costly and heavy so it's important to find the right one that has some serious style impact while at the same time trying to keep the price down if possible.
